Galen Weston

The Space Between

2017-11-16

I really liked the start of this cd. I started out with some nice good foot tapping beats. The Saxophone started to chime in as well as it progressed. The unfortunate part was that as it progressed it started to sound more and more the same. The beats and sounds started to sound blended together and really didn't do much for me.
